Abstract

The covid-19 pandemic forced education to seek new ways of teaching and learning In particular, due to the fact that experimental sciences such as chemistry require training in the laboratory and that attendance at these training spaces was interrupted by social isolation, the need arose to investigate new ways of acquiring procedural skills. The objective of this work was to estimate the usefulness of a didactic material, a computerized practice, in the academic achievement of students through the analysis of the experimental performance obtained before and during the use of the computerized practice. It was observed that the students who had the didactic material at their disposal improved their performance, measured by the Hake index. For this reason, it is estimated that computerized practice is useful to improve academic performance in the practice laboratory.
